Quintana
Quintana is a station on Line 5 of the Madrid Metro, located under the Plaza de Quintana. It is located in fare Zone A.Photo: Xauxa, CC BY-SA 3.0.

Las Ventas
Stadium
Photo: Zaqarbal,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Plaza de Toros de Las Ventas, known simply as Las Ventas, is the largest bullfighting ring in Spain, located in the Guindalera quarter of the Salamanca district of Madrid. Las Ventas is situated 1¼ km west of Quintana.

Ventas
Quarter
Photo: Michiel1972,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Ventas is an administrative neighborhood of Madrid located within the district of Ciudad Lineal. It covers an area of 3.198045 km2. As of 1 March 2020, it has a population of 49,198.
